Marjoram Essential Oil

Marjoram is a spicy perennial plant. In the process of growing marjoram, a significant part of the essential oil of marjoram accumulates in the flowering tops. By itself, marjoram is used as a spice in cooking, has a wide range of useful properties, due to which it has partially established itself in medicine.

Marjoram essential oil is a clear liquid, spicy in taste and smells like camphor. Marjoram essential oil is widely used in pharmaceutical activities, as it interacts well with alcohol. You can buy marjoram oil in pharmacies - both pharmaceutical and homeopathic. As a plant, marjoram is included in the recipes of various dishes that are found in most of the world's leading cuisines. The use of marjoram oil for treatment is possible in various ways. During a cold, you can add a drop of marjoram oil during the inhalation procedure. Marjoram oil can be applied topically to bruises or rough skin. For various inflammations, a few drops of marjoram oil can be added to a hot bath.

In addition to health therapy and culinary arts, marjoram oil is used as a flavoring agent for perfumes, cosmetics, various alcoholic and non-alcoholic drinks.
